TouchBistro features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    TouchBistro offers an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, making it accessible for staff of varying technical proficiency. This can result in quicker staff training and smoother operations.
  • iPad Compatibility
    The system is designed to work seamlessly with iPads, ensuring mobility and flexibility in a fast-paced restaurant environment. Servers can easily take orders and process payments directly at the table.
  • Comprehensive Features
    TouchBistro provides a wide range of features, including inventory management, menu customization, and customer relationship management (CRM). These features help streamline restaurant operations and enhance the customer experience.
  • Offline Mode
    The system operates even without an Internet connection, allowing restaurants to continue their operations uninterrupted in case of connectivity issues.
  • Strong Customer Support
    TouchBistro offers robust customer support services, including 24/7 phone support, training resources, and an online help center to assist with troubleshooting and optimization.

Possible disadvantages of TouchBistro

  • Subscription Cost
    The pricing model is subscription-based, which may be costly for small restaurants, especially those operating on a tight budget.
  • Hardware Requirements
    While the iPad compatibility is a pro, it also means that restaurants need to invest in Apple hardware, which can be more expensive than alternatives.
  • Limited Integrations
    TouchBistro has fewer integrations with third-party applications compared to some other POS systems. This may limit its adaptability for restaurants that rely on multiple software solutions for different aspects of their business.
  • Complex Initial Setup
    The initial setup and customization process can be complex and time-consuming, which might be challenging for restaurants without dedicated IT staff.
  • Learning Curve
    Despite its user-friendly design, the system's extensive features can create a steep learning curve for staff, requiring comprehensive training and adjustment time.

rEFIt features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    rEFIt provides an easy-to-use graphical boot menu, making it accessible for users at various skill levels to manage and select between different operating systems and boot options.
  • Mac Compatibility
    rEFIt is specifically designed to work on Intel-based Macintosh computers, offering seamless integration and functionality tailored to Apple's hardware.
  • Customization Options
    The tool allows customization of boot entries and themes, enabling users to personalize their boot process according to their preferences.
  • Dual-Boot Support
    rEFIt facilitates easy dual-boot configurations, allowing users to run multiple operating systems on a single Mac device effectively.

Possible disadvantages of rEFIt

  • Lack of Active Development
    rEFIt has not seen active development or updates in several years, which means it may not support newer hardware or software features.
  • Potential Compatibility Issues
    As Mac hardware and software continue to evolve, rEFIt may encounter compatibility issues, leading to potential difficulties during the boot process.
  • Complex Setup for Non-Standard Use Cases
    While rEFIt is generally user-friendly, setting it up for advanced or non-standard configurations can be complex and may require additional technical knowledge.
  • Limited Support Resources
    Given its age and the lack of recent activity, finding support from the community or official sources might be challenging for resolving specific issues.
